1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a sentence?
Back
A sentence is a group of words that expresses a complete thought.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does it mean to ride something?
Back
To ride something means to sit on it and travel, like riding a bike or an airplane.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a subject in a sentence?
Back
The subject is the person, place, thing, or idea that the sentence is about.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a verb?
Back
A verb is an action word that tells what the subject is doing.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a complete thought?
Back
A complete thought is an idea that makes sense on its own and does not leave you wondering.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a noun?
Back
A noun is a word that names a person, place, thing, or idea.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the purpose of a period in a sentence?
Back
A period shows that the sentence has ended.
